Belarus' deputy PM sees mobile user base up to 8 mln by 2010

MINSK, Oct 27 (Prime-Tass) -- The mobile services subscriber base in Belarus is expected to increase to 8 million by 2010 from the current 5.5 million, Viktor Burya, deputy prime minister, told the parliament Friday.

Belarus? mobile market is split among Mobile Digital Communications (MDC), MTS Belarus, Belarus Telecommunications Network, or BeST, and BelCel. The first three operate GSM networks, while BelCel operates an IMT-MC-450, or CDMA2000, network.

As of October 1, Belarus had 3.3 million fixed lines, including 2.8 million residential fixed lines, Burya said.

Belarus' population is just under 10 million people and is declining.
